Add --shared flag to bd hooks install for versioned hooks
Implements support for installing git hooks to a versioned directory (.beads-hooks/) that can be committed to the repository and shared with team members. This solves the team collaboration issue where hooks need to be installed in pre-built containers. Changes: - Add --shared flag to 'bd hooks install' command - Install hooks to .beads-hooks/ when --shared is used - Automatically configure git config core.hooksPath - Update help text to explain shared mode Fixes #229
